Position Title:
Manager Analytics - Canada**
Location: Brampton, ON

Reports to:
Sr. Manager, International Analytics


Position Overview

Responsibilities:

Specific responsibilities will include but are not limited to:

  • Deliver analytic insights, pertaining to Canada, in several business domains including customer, digital, market & share performance.
  • Partner with key stakeholders in the Sales and Commercialization teams to support/optimize innovation launches, promotional strategies, and merchandising activities.
  • Collaborate with Sales team on monthly and yearly forecasting processes.
  • Develop indepth business, analytical, and systems knowledge to improve/build analytical solutions, approaches, and business recommendations.
  • Interpret complex customer & business data to develop an organized set of conclusions/recommendations.
  • Provide ongoing insights on industry, customer, and marketplace trends using syndicated data to support the category strategy.
  • Provide analytic leadership including, but not limited to, business case support, business level productivity and sales results, and business review support.
  • Drive the continued enhancement and evolution of our analytics capabilities to a bestinclass level. Stays abreast of industry trends and innovations and drive new analytics initiatives that contribute to business goals.

Key Interfaces:
Sales, Demand Generation, Commercialization (marketing, category development and customer strategic planning), Supply Chain, IT & Finance

Key Qualifications:

  • Previous analytics leadership experience and technical qualifications:
  • 4+ years of direct and hands-on Retail/CPG experience specific experience preferred.
  • Data driven, with an analytical / problem solving mindset.
  • Proven experience drawing actionable conclusions from POS, Invoice, Supply Chain, Marketing, and Promotional metrics to provide a holistic view of online growth.
  • Skill blending diverse data from different platforms, formats, and environments.
  • A broad understanding of analytical processes including but not limited to: data management, forecasting, optimization, predictive modeling, and visualization.
  • Advanced skills with all Microsoft Office Software for the creation of management reports, presentations, and analysis.
  • Preferred experience with business intelligence & reporting tools such as Power BI, Tableau, or Qlik.
  • Familiarity with market research and syndicated data providers (IRI, Nielsen, NPD) a plus.
  • Strong communication skills including the ability to deliver a clear story to different audiences to influence agreement to your recommendations with data and insights.
  • Selfmotivated to work with diverse, complicated questionsprioritizing multiple priorities across multiple functions.
  • Conceptual thinker with proven analytical & problemsolving skills to see "big picture".
  • Management experience preferred.
